Ticket: config drift on the Pellamy firmware update channel. Fleet audit found edge devices in the Norbeck region pinned to the beta channel while the manifest says stable. Drift likely introduced by last month's manual hotfix; automation never reverted it. Action: reconcile before Thursday's rollout or hold it. For the weekly sync, the intended channel configuration is recorded below.

config for kawif-hahig:
zorix:
  log_level: error
  metrics_host: metrics.zorix.lumiclabs.internal
  pool_size: 16

## Step 6: Invalidate the Pellgrove catalog cache

After the new catalog build is live, trigger invalidation carefully: first warm the standby cache tier, then publish the invalidation event to the catalog topic. Do not skip the warm-up — cold misses against the pricing service have caused timeouts before. Confirm hit rates recover above 92% within ten minutes before proceeding. The invalidation event must be signed or edge consumers will silently drop it; sign it with the key below.

release key, bawef-yagap: bky9_B5txx7RXt

## Deploying the Gatewick Proctor Queue

Deploys are pretty painless: push to main, wait for the pipeline, then watch the queue drain dashboard for five minutes. If candidates pile up mid-exam, roll back first and ask questions later — the queue replays safely. Everything the workers care about lives in one config block, shown here for reference.

settings of bafof-yagef:
JOROX_PIN=8740
JOROX_TENANT=pelox
JOROX_METRICS_HOST=metrics.jorox.qorvelworks.internal
JOROX_SEAL=seal_c78f63c1
JOROX_STANDBY_TEAM=norax